G and P Manufacturing would like to minimize the labor cost of producing dishwasher motors for a major appliance manufacturer.Although two models of motors exist,the finished models are indistinguishable from one another;their cost difference is due to a different production sequence.The time in hours required for each model in each production area is tabled here,along with the labor cost.
Currently labor assignments provide for 10,000 hours in each of Areas A and B and 18000 hours in Area C.If 2000 hours are available to be transferred from area B to Area A,3000 hours are available to be transferred from area C to either Areas A or B,develop the linear programming model whose solution would tell G&P how many of each model to produce and how to allocate the workforce.
